Kensington Olympia is equipped with ticket machines for collecting tickets purchased online, and the machines are accessible to ensure ease of use for everyone. Unfortunately, the station lacks a staffed ticket office or smartcard issuance and validation facilities. However, help points around the station ensure that assistance is always within reach.
Accessibility within the station is well-considered. While there is step-free access, transferring between platforms requires a brief journey outside the station via street level. Although accessible toilets are not available, standard toilets and baby-changing facilities can be found on site. For those with mobility needs, staff assistance is available, and a "Turn-up-and-go" service is offered by London Overground – a convenient option for those who prefer spontaneous travel.
Passengers can enjoy a comfortable wait in the large seating area since there's no designated waiting room. For refreshments, a coffee kiosk satisfies small cravings, with shops located nearby, as well as an ATM for any last-minute cash needs.
The station sits conveniently within a network of transport connections, making onward travel seamless. From the London Underground, the District line services are available, particularly on weekends and public holidays. If you're planning a trip to Heathrow, you simply need to hop on this line and switch to the Piccadilly line at Earls Court.
For surface travel, buses are readily accessible, with specific stops for eastbound services to Shepherd's Bush and westbound journeys to Clapham Junction along Holland Road. Unfortunately, there are no direct airport links from Kensington Olympia, but convenient connections to major stations and destinations like Clapham Junction facilitate easy transfer options.

Stepping into Folkestone Central, you're greeted by a welcoming environment that caters to all your travel necessities. For those purchasing or collecting tickets, the station boasts a ticket office open from Monday to Saturday, 6:00 to 19:00, and on Sundays from 8:10 to 17:40. Ticket machines are available for added convenience, with the capability to collect p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is a priority here, with an induction loop and accessible ticket machines located in the booking hall.
For individuals requiring assistance, there are customer help points and detailed staff support available. Travel information features through comprehensive departure screens and announcements, ensuring you are always updated with the latest schedule information. While luggage storage isn't available, you can rest easy knowing CCTV is in operation for enhanced security.
Passengers with mobility needs can navigate the station effortlessly thanks to step-free access across all platforms. Facilities such as accessible toilets, ramps for train access, and wheelchairs ensure a barrier-free environment. The station also offers four accessible parking spaces, although accessible car park equipment is not installed. Heated waiting rooms and adequate seating areas make waiting for your train a comfortable experience.
Beyond rail services, Folkestone Central is well-connected by other modes of transport. If your journey continues by bus, you'll find information for onward travel plans and services easily accessible from the station. The rail replacement bus stop is conveniently located just beyond the station, details of which can be accessed through this link.
The station hosts a taxi rank at the front, ready to whisk you away to your next destination with little fuss. If you're planning routes either locally or further afield, various bus services also run near the station. More detailed information and printable timetables can be found here.
When it comes to destinations, Folkestone Central opens up a world of possibilities. Direct trains to bustling hubs like London St Pancras International and London Bridge allow for swift access to the capital's numerous attractions. For international journeys, a quick hop to Ashford International connects you to Eurostar services.
Coastal escapes abound with trains to Dover Priory and Ramsgate. The historic city of Canterbury, known for its stunning cathedral, is also a short journey away. The station makes it easy to set off on adventures across Kent's enchanting countryside.
